Alyona Sotnikova

Alyona is a Russian-born, New York–based architectural, interior, and set designer. She graduated from the Saint Petersburg Academy of Fine Arts, where she received a professional degree in architecture, accompanied by rigorous training in the Russian school of academic drawing.
Passionate about spatial design, Alyona worked in Saint Petersburg as an interior and exhibition designer, contributing to several exhibition projects at the Bolshoi Drama Theater. She also collaborated with an independent director from the Bolshoi Puppet Theater as a set designer for The Ballad of the Small Tugboat by Joseph Brodsky, which later premiered in Moscow and remains in the theater’s repertoire.
Alyona moved to the U.S. to pursue her Master of Architecture at the Harvard Graduate School of Design, where she deepened her study of set design history and contributed to several student theater productions. She currently lives and works in New York as an architectural designer and is thrilled to join The Mutt as set designer. This opportunity allows her to draw on her cultural background, professional experience, and love of Russian literature while collaborating with an inspiring creative team.
